MongoDBReview
MongoDB Atlas is a cloud-based database service designed for developers and solo entrepreneurs who need robust data storage solutions without the overhead of managing infrastructure.
What you can do with MongoDB
Overview
MongoDB Atlas is a cloud-based database service designed for developers and solo entrepreneurs who need robust data storage solutions without the overhead of managing infrastructure. The primary use case for solo users is building scalable applications or prototypes that require high performance and reliability. MongoDB's core value proposition lies in its ability to offer flexible pricing tiers, from free options suitable for learning and testing to dedicated plans for production environments.
Key Features
- Auto-scaling: Automatically adjusts resources based on demand, optimizing both cost and performance.
- Shared Resources (Free/Flex Plans): Utilizes shared storage and CPU resources, ideal for small-scale projects or development purposes.
- Dedicated Resources (Dedicated Plan): Offers dedicated vCPUs, RAM, and storage tailored to production-level requirements with predictable performance.
- Multi-cloud Deployment: Supports deployment on AWS, Google Cloud, and Azure, providing flexibility in cloud provider choices.
- MongoDB Search: Enables building relevance-based search functionality 4x faster than alternative solutions at a significantly lower cost.
- Pricing Calculator: A tool to estimate costs based on specific storage and performance needs.
- Cluster Selector Tool: Helps identify the right Atlas cluster tier by inputting your storage and performance requirements.
Pricing
MongoDB Atlas offers three main tiers:
- Free Plan: $0/month
- Storage: Up to 5 GB (shared)
- RAM: Shared
- vCPU: Shared
- Max Operations/Second: ≤100 ops/s
- Collaborators: Unlimited
- API Calls: see official website
- Flex Plan: $2.88/month ($0.011/hour)
- Storage: Up to 5 GB (shared)
- RAM: Shared
- vCPU: Shared
- Max Operations/Second: ≤100 ops/s
- Collaborators: Unlimited
- Dedicated Plan: $168/month ($0.08/hour)
- Storage: 10 GB (dedicated)
- RAM: 2 GB (dedicated)
- vCPU: 2vCPUs (dedicated)
- Max Operations/Second: ≤500 ops/s
- Collaborators: Unlimited
Pros
- Auto-scaling: Ensures optimal performance and cost efficiency by automatically adjusting resources based on demand.
- Multi-cloud Support: Flexibility in choosing between AWS, Google Cloud, or Azure for deployment.
- MongoDB Search Integration: Provides a powerful search solution that is both faster and more cost-effective than alternatives.
- Free Tier with No Credit Card Required: Ideal for learning, testing, and small-scale projects without any upfront commitment.
- Pricing Calculator and Cluster Selector Tool: Helps estimate costs accurately based on specific needs.
Cons
- Learning Curve: Requires time to understand the nuances of MongoDB's features and configurations.
- Costs Can Escalate Quickly: Moving from Flex to Dedicated plans can be expensive for solo users with growing projects.
- No Offline Access: All operations must be performed online, which may not suit those who work in environments without constant internet access.
Best For
- Freelancers juggling multiple client projects who need a scalable and reliable database solution.
- Indie hackers building prototypes or MVPs that require robust data handling capabilities.
- Developers looking to deploy production-ready applications with dedicated resources for performance assurance.
vs Alternatives
- Obsidian: FREE (optional $25 "Catalyst" donation)
- Offline-first, allowing users to work without an internet connection and sync later.
- Trello Standard: $5/user/month
- Offers a visual Kanban board interface that is intuitive for project management tasks.
- Make: Free up to 1,000 ops/month
- Provides extensive automation capabilities with a many integrations, ideal for workflow optimization.
- Notion: FREE (unlimited blocks for solo users)
- Combines notes, tasks, wikis, and databases into one workspace, offering flexibility in organizing various types of content.
Compare alternatives
Frequently Asked Questions
MongoDB Atlas is a cloud-based database service designed for developers and solo entrepreneurs who need robust data storage solutions without the overhead of managing infrastructure.
Flex Plan ($2.88/mo), Dedicated Plan ($168/mo)
Yes! Top alternatives include: Obsidian, Trello Standard, Make. Browse the Tools section for more.
Newsletter
Stay up to date
Weekly picks: new tools and dev trends. No spam.